BOOKS FOR ALL

Kutumb is a member of the Free Libraries Network (FLN), which brings together libraries from India and South Asia to offer member libraries access to reading materials, programmes, knowledge resources, and information. As members, we advocate for a free library movement that welcomes all people to the right to read.

Kutumb runs aspects of the Books-For-All programme, in which libraries, including those affiliated with FLN, receive curated book collections, librarianship capacity building opportunities and more.

This is sustained by book donations from publishers as well as individuals. We have sent thousands of free books to first-generation library users,  to be used by over 100 community libraries across the country in English, Hindi, Marathi, Urdu, Bangla, Odiya, and Tamil, from publishers such as Tulika, Eklavya, Ektara, Vishv Books, Pratham, and A&A.

We also organised and facilitated residential library trainings, book collection studies, workshops, and internships, to help develop the free library movement.
